Subject: Songs For A Slideshow
From: GUEST,Ariesssor
Date: 19 May 03 - 03:35 AM

I have spent the last 3 months going through every picture I have ever taken to create a slideshow. I thought it would be a great gift to give to my husband for Father's Day. I have all the photos in order, but I am drawing a complete blank as to which songs I should have for the background music. To me, the music is just as important as the pictures for a slideshow. It just seems to add that "special something". So if anyone has any suggestions - ideas for that perfect song , I would really appreciate it. The pictures in the slideshow consist of my Husband & I and our children. Kind of a timeline from when we first met, baby pictures, photos of the kids as they've grown, vacations, that sort of thing.

I already have songs for the parts with just my Husband & I, (every couple does), but I cannot think of any appropriate songs for the parts with just our kids and family photos.

PLEASE HELP!!!!

Subject: RE: Songs For A Slideshow
From: Blackcatter
Date: 19 May 03 - 12:43 PM

Try using your kids favorite songs and songs that you listened to on vacation. When they were young, did you sing together? if so, use those songs.

Subject: RE: Songs For A Slideshow
From: Mudlark
Date: 20 May 03 - 01:00 AM

How about Teach Your Children Well and/or Turn Turn Turn, maybe a lullabye if appropriate to what's on the screen, Mountain Greenery, if there are camping scenes....what a great project!
